QUOTE (Stewart Little @ Aug 4 2016, 12:24)

А это смотря в каких библиотеках.
Если говорить о библиотеках периферийных модулей в Qsys (куда входит SPI, и куда можно добавить I2C), то эти модули бесплатные, и никаких ограничений не имеют.
А если говорить о библиотеках IP-ядер квартуса - сейчас это называется IP Catalog (и куда входит в том числе PCI), то большинство этих ядер платные и требуют лицензирования. При отсутствии лицензии большинство IP-ядер можно использовать в оценочном режиме OpenCore Plus. Об особенностях и ограничениях этого режима см. альтеровскитй документ
AN 320: OpenCore Plus Evaluation of Megafunctions:
https://www.altera.com/content/dam/altera-w...re/an/an320.pdfБесплатным является также использование аппаратных ядер (HIP) - например аппаратных контроллеров PCI Express или аппаратных контролллеров внешней DDRx памяти.
Небольшое дополнение: OpenCore Plus работает не на всяком железе.
Это я получил на 10AX115N4F45E3SG:
"Warning: The current device family does not support the
OpenCore Plus hardware evaluation feature"
Собственно an320 подтверждает, но мутно.
Вот если бы по клику на IP_Catalog:Details писали об ограничениях и лицензиях...